What on earth is a gray divorce?
Gray divorce refers to marriages concerning partners aged 50 or higher than that have ended, at the same time as General divorce costs continue to decline in The usa. While All round premiums may have fallen, gray divorce has experienced an uptick given that 2000 for many factors for example vacant nest syndrome, economical disagreements and infidelity in addition to personalized advancement later on in life. Despite why a relationship finishes It is really essential that couples more than 50 recognize what can manifest when it does lastly take place.

The increase of gray divorce may be traced to a number of factors. Most notably, relationship has arrive at be defined differently with increased focus on own fulfillment and individualism (Berardo 1982). On top of that, Girls's improved monetary independence has made divorce extra very likely in comparison with earlier a long time.
